Dear All,
Can we change the license type DLU to UCL without upgrading CUCM version (current v.8.6.2) and without active UCSS/ESW contract?

Hi Frank,
Before u do major upgarde, upload all un-unsed DLUs to Call manager.
Secondly,if u have any free DLUs, that would get converted to UCL Enhanced/ Enhanced Plus after the major upgrade is done . This can be done only after u do successful migration to CUCM 9 or 10.
Further , if u purchase UCL now for CUCM 8 , the same would work as DLU after u upload the licenses in CUCM 8.x.
Un-used DLUs get converted to enhanced UCL be default if u do not mention to licensing team.

for new purchases:
Start with Top Level part number R-CUCM-USR-LIC
LIC-CUCM-USR-A UCL - 1 Enhanced User, Tier A, 1-999 users
LIC-CUCM-USR-B UCL - 1 Enhanced User, Tier B, 1000-9999 users
LIC-CUCM-USR-C UCL - 1 Enhanced User, Tier C, 10,000 and greater users
LIC-CUCM-BASIC-A UCL - 1 Basic User, Tier A, 1-999 users
LIC-CUCM-BASIC-B UCL - 1 Basic User, Tier B, 1000-9999 users
LIC-CUCM-BASIC-C UCL - 1 Basic User, Tier C, 10,000 and greater users
LIC-CUCM-ESS-A UCL - 1 Essential, or an application user add-on
LIC-CUCM-ESS-B UCL - 1 Essential, or an application user add-on
LIC-CUCM-ESS-C UCL - 1 Essential, or an application user add-on
